I initially bought these in a 12 petite as that's my most common size in Athleta pants (and the size I have in my unlined Brooklyn ankle pants) and these were huge! I sized down to 10 petite and they fit. The quality is good and the lining is soft, like the lining of the Attitude 2, though not in contrast. However, I could not figure out what to wear them with. I have more than 50 pieces of Athleta clothing and nothing worked. Just felt really bulky and it seems like the outfit the model is wearing is the only way to style them, including a trainer/sneaker without socks showing, which isn't very practical in cold weather. Plus I would still have to hem the petite version by two inches. For some reason the lined version with the wider leg having a stripe on the side just didn't go together (for my taste) so I returned the second pair too. I would love for other people to post their photos of how they are styling them and for Athleta to continue to offer some lined/warmer options in travel pants.

I'm a snowshoe/winter hike/ice hike addict living in the mountains of Northeastern PA. My motto is there is no bad weather, just bad gear. I've got fleece and down-lined pants from another retailer for the coldest of the cold weather that I wouldn't trade for the world. However functional those pants are, they aren't exactly attractive. These Brooklyn lined pants provide the perfect hiking pant for upper 30s to low 50s (they can work in colder temps with an underlayer). Just as importantly, they are beautifully tailored, so if I find myself going from a morning hike to a casual lunch, I don't feel as if I look like a mountain Yeti. I do wish they would come in other colors, but black always works. For reference, I am 5'7", 130 pounds and I bought a size 8 and it fits to my liking. I have have slim hips and thighs and there is plenty of room through the seat without bulk, I could probably do a 6 if I were just wearing them out to lunch, but I like my hiking pants to be roomy enough for a merino underlayer. They wash up nicely if you put them in the dryer for 2-3 minutes and then hang dry after that. I find that method keeps the lining from shrinking more than the shell. Would highly recommend.
